I use the Resmed Quattro FX. I have a small face and it seemed like the headgear was too big. To make it fit, the straps would go back so far that the velcro was in my hair, rather than on itself. I ended up ordering a small size of headgear (special order, does NOT come automatically, even on a small mask), and that made a huge difference for me. Solved my major leaks that I had fought with the first 6 weeks.SleepCatz wrote:I've been on CPAP therapy two weeks and slowly starting to feel better.
